The criteria below assume applicants are either full-time journalists or journalism is the applicant's main function. The HIMSS Strategic Communications team defines a journalist as authors of original content for a media outlet or publication on a regular basis. Journalists approved for general media credentials are expected to use that access for the purpose of covering the topics of health information and technology during HIMSS24.

Individuals who do not qualify as accredited media in any of the following categories must register as an attendee to access the HIMSS24 campus.
Journalists from print, broadcast or newswire news organizations can receive HIMSS event press credentials if their publication's website has the individual's name listed as part of the reporting team.
Publishers and copy/content editors do not qualify for press credentials. Members of the organization in executive management, administration and/or research do not qualify for press credentials.
In some cases, a journalist's publication may also be exhibiting at HIMSS24. In those circumstances, journalists must apply as press or as an exhibitor, but not both.

Sponsored bloggers, bloggers for company pages, personal website writers, consultants who blog to promote businesses, designers, public relations professionals and copy/content editors do not qualify for press credentials.

Marketing, public relations or other industry executives who contribute bylined articles to news outlets do not qualify for press credentials. You must register under the assigning publication's name and not your individual business name.
HIMSS allows analysts from recognized industry firms to receive press credentials if they can provide a bylined, published report related to the health IT industry published within the past six months.
Analysts and consultants who develop a client-only publication for their own firm or another firm do not qualify for press credentials. Financial analysts and consultants do not qualify for press credentials.
To apply for press credentials, complete the HIMSS24 press registration. Press pick up their badges in the press room at HIMSS24 in Orlando. Those accepted as press for HIMSS24 have access to conference events (not including events with additional costs), the exhibit hall during regular hours, a room equipped with WiFi, and charging stations.
All media credentials are provided at the discretion of the HIMSS Strategic Communications team. HIMSS Strategic Communications team reserves the right to accept or deny press credentials.
